Review of The Ex (2006) by Lilly P — 26 Apr 2008
This aint a damn funny film. It is a smiley funny film. It dont make you really laugh but it also dont make you want to turn it off. It's all the more watchable because of the cast. 2 of the kings of classic sitcoms - Braff from Scrubs and Bateman from Arrested Development - in the same film is what sells it and it works for the most part coz of them.
Bateman is the better of the 2 as he gets the funnier role whilst Braff does his usual turn as the everyman type who is struggling with being a geezer in a modern world. Nice supporting turns from Charles Grodin and Paul Rudd pops up at the beginning too.
Dont expect a lot and you'll get a breezy, bright and fun film.
